Building on a Family Heritage
Founded in Frederick, Maryland, Simple Theory Wine Co carries forward the pioneering spirit of the Aellen family’s vineyard legacy established in 1972. Melissa and Parker's grandparents initiated grape cultivation in the area, eventually helping establish the Linganore American Viticultural Area (AVA) in 1983. This federally designated region paved the way for Maryland's wine production, influencing the future of local vineyards.

Commitment to Sustainability
One of the central themes of Simple Theory Wine Co is sustainability. The winery's vineyard spans twenty-five acres, which are cultivated using eco-friendly practices. Aellen emphasizes that the winery is committed to innovative and environmentally respectful farming methods, including integrated pest management and dry farming techniques; these reduce the need for chemical applications.
The production facility leverages solar energy, showcasing their long-term commitment to environmental stewardship. They aspire to achieve B Corp certification, which underscores their dedication to social and environmental responsibility within the local community.
